Output eabfa7fef8fb4214ccb673ff43d39da229162ab19484b6aaacda152840bc8644:23

value
490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b2598bd7586dee20e48683a9a6c9f0829fd5555 OP_EQUALVERIFY OP_CHECKSIG
address
19JwXiauSJGgZcv1fDvtPjLJsjwWxQyMB4
transaction
eabfa7fef8fb4214ccb673ff43d39da229162ab19484b6aaacda152840bc8644
confirmations
10095
spent
true